Official abstract text for this publication.
A spray orifice structure for which, when spraying liquid contents onto a body part, such as a face, hair, an upper body or a lower body, by using a spray type container, it is possible to provide a user with a differentiated spray performance depending on each body part to be sprayed by manufacturing a spray orifice in consideration of an injection angle to which liquid contents are sprayed.

What is claimed is: 1. A spray orifice structure, the spray orifice structure coupled to a discharging part of a spray injection button to spray liquid contents to the outside, comprising an outer orifice coupled at the discharging part and forming an outer orifice which has an inner orifice insertion hole such that an inner orifice can be inserted therein, wherein the outer orifice comprises a first injection hole which has a conical shape, formed with a diameter getting smaller from a distal end of the inner orifice insertion hole to a front end side thereof, and a second injection hole which extends from the front end side of the first injection hole and has a predetermined diameter and a predetermined length, such that an injection angle in which liquid contents are injected is determined by the proportion of the predetermined diameter and the predetermined length of the second injection hole, wherein a fillet part with a rounded edge is formed at a circumference of a front end side of the second injection hole. 2. The spray orifice structure of claim 1 , wherein when the predetermined diameter and the predetermined length are set to 0.3 mm and 0.6 mm respectively, the injection angle is to be determined to 70°. 3. The spray orifice structure of claim 1 , wherein the injection angle is to be determined to 40° when the predetermined diameter and the predetermined length of the second injection hole are set respectively to 0.3 mm and 0.8 mm. 4. The spray orifice structure of claim 1 , wherein the fillet part has a rounded edge with a radius of 0.1 mm.
